    Understanding Bitcoin's Volatility: A Rollercoaster Ride to 2035

    When we talk about Bitcoin price prediction 2035, one of the first things that comes to mind is its infamous volatility. Bitcoin's journey has been nothing short of a rollercoaster, with breathtaking highs and stomach-churning lows. This inherent unpredictability is what makes both its investment potential and its forecasting so exciting and challenging. Historically, Bitcoin's price movements have been driven by a complex interplay of factors: supply and demand dynamics, macroeconomic events, technological developments, and simply, market sentiment. Remember the huge rallies of 2017 or 2021? Those were fueled by a mix of retail frenzy, institutional interest, and growing awareness. Conversely, significant pullbacks often follow periods of rapid growth, sometimes exacerbated by regulatory FUD (fear, uncertainty, doubt), major hacks, or broader economic downturns. Understanding this historical context is absolutely crucial for anyone trying to wrap their head around a Bitcoin price in 2035. It's not just a linear ascent; it's a cyclical dance of boom and bust, often tied to its four-year halving cycle, which we'll discuss later. What makes Bitcoin unique is its fixed supply cap of 21 million coins, which inherently creates scarcity. As demand grows, and supply diminishes relative to that demand, the price should theoretically rise over the long term. However, the path isn't smooth. We've seen how quickly sentiment can shift, how a single tweet from an influential figure can move markets, or how an unexpected regulatory announcement can send ripples through the crypto space. The market capitalization of Bitcoin is still relatively small compared to traditional asset classes like gold or major stock indices, making it more susceptible to large price swings.     Technological Advancements: Building a Better Bitcoin for 2035

    Thinking about Bitcoin price prediction 2035, it’s absolutely essential to consider the relentless pace of technological advancement within the Bitcoin ecosystem itself. While Bitcoin's core protocol is designed to be stable and secure, continuous innovation around it is vital for its long-term viability and growth. We're talking about improvements that make Bitcoin faster, cheaper, more scalable, and even more private. The biggest buzz often surrounds scalability solutions like the Lightning Network. Right now, Bitcoin's main blockchain processes transactions relatively slowly compared to traditional payment networks. The Lightning Network, however, allows for near-instant, low-cost transactions off-chain, settling them on the main chain later. If the Lightning Network truly matures and achieves widespread adoption by 2035, it could transform Bitcoin into a practical, everyday payment method for micro-transactions, significantly expanding its utility beyond just a store of value. This enhanced utility would directly impact its demand and, therefore, its price in 2035.
